D.J. Shaw

37 books

681 pages digital 2022

fiction fantasy adventurous fast-paced

162 pages 2012

science fiction mysterious fast-paced

614 pages digital 2015

10 pages digital 2013

dark funny slow-paced

37 pages digital 2015

38 pages digital 2015

39 pages digital 2015

39 pages 2015

challenging dark slow-paced

2615 pages digital

fiction fantasy romance adventurous dark fast-paced